Rapid Bike add-on ECUs install beside the stock ECU. They do not replace the OEM control unit. On a motorcycle like the R 1200 GS, that approach is ideal when you want better fueling control, more consistent throttle feel, or additional map options without a full standalone ECU project.

Rapid Bike modules help refine how the motorcycle delivers its power: mixture quality in closed loop, injection map behavior, and on higher kits ignition-related control. That matters when altitude, temperature, load, or aftermarket exhaust / intake setups change demand.

Rapid Bike module details (matched to this motorcycle)

  • Rapid Bike Easy — focused on O2 / lambda closed-loop optimization. Compact plug-and-play when mixture management is the priority.
  • Rapid Bike Evoinjection map management, real-time lambda control, and self-adaptive fueling. The balanced street / travel option where listed.
  • Rapid Bike Racing — adds ignition advance related control plus engine-brake / limiter-oriented features for more aggressive setups.

Install and validation checklist

  1. Confirm your motorcycle year against the 04→07 / 08→09 / 10→12 / 13→16 / 17→18 pill on this page.
  2. Open the chosen Rapid Bike product and verify Item Kit + Wiring codes for that year window.
  3. Install using the kit manual; keep connectors clean and route the loom away from heat and moving parts.
  4. Validate on a controlled ride: idle, low-gear tip-in, mid-range roll-on, and steady cruise in your typical use.
  5. If you change exhaust, intake, or regularly ride at very different altitudes, reassess maps / adaptive behavior instead of assuming the first setup stays ideal forever.
